Before I retired I worked as a special agent for Homeland Security Investigations at the Human Rights Violators and War Crimes Unit. I've kept in touch with a number of the guys through social media, etc. Anyway, after seeing some of the pictures I've posted of some of my knives, one of the guys suggested a serial numbered knife with some engraving representative of the unit and our work. This is a prototype of the knife I came up with for the unit. The blade is AEB-L taken to a 400 grit satin finish. The handle material is carbon fiber. The knife when closed measures just under 5", open it measure just a little above 8 3/4". The cutting edge is approximately 3.75". In general I'm please with the way it turned out. Glad it's a prototype because there are some things that I will have to change going forward. Thanks for looking.
